Crypto Magnate Kwon Pleads Guilty to Defrauding Investors of $40 Billion

Montenegrin police officers escort Terraform Labs founder Do Kwon in Montenegro’s capital, Podgorica, on March 23, 2024. AP Photo/Risto Bozovic, File

Do Hyeong Kwon, cofounder of blockchain and crypto company Terraform Labs, has pled guilty to fraud, admitting that he engaged in criminal schemes that cost investors and users billions of dollars.

Kwon had marketed Terraform as a self-contained and decentralized financial ecosystem leveraging its own blockchain technology, the Justice Department said in an Aug. 12 statement.
